How much is the expense of driving from Canterbury to Gateshead?
The expense of driving from Canterbury to Gateshead using petrol amounts to £57.7. This computation is based on a petrol price of 144 pence per liter and a car's fuel efficiency of 37.5 miles per gallon. For those considering carpooling arrangements, the cost per passenger decreases with more occupants. With two passengers, the cost per person is £28.85 (£57.7 divided by 2). With three passengers, it's approximately £19.23 per person (£57.7 divided by 3), and with four passengers, it's £14.43 per person (£57.7 divided by 4).
To delve deeper into the calculations, we can explore the fuel cost calculation. This is determined by the distance traveled and the car's fuel consumption rate. For this journey, approximately 40.1 liters of fuel would be required. Multiplying this by the petrol price per liter results in the total fuel cost of £57.7 for the trip from Canterbury to Gateshead.
